However, during the 90 days prior to bankruptcy a stream of communications from True Fitness pressured for payments with the implication that further shipments would not otherwise be made.

In other cases where preference defendants have successfully proven ordinary course of business defenses, the defendants have also presented evidence of their competitors’ receivables and collections practices and of the actual payment practices of the defendants’ competitors’ customers. In Solow, supra, the evidence included the debtor’s payment history to its other law firms and also evidence of the defendant’s competitors’ accounts receivables practices and the aging of their accounts. Solow, 180 B.R. The Solow bankruptcy court expressly distinguished that case from another in which the defendant’s president had admitted that he had no knowledge of his competitors’ receivables practices. In late 1997, Questor Partners Fund, led by Jay Alix and Dan Lufkin, purchased Schwinn Bicycles. Questor/Schwinn later purchased GT Bicycles in 1998 for $8 a share in cash, roughly $80 million. The new company produced a series of well-regarded mountain bikes bearing the Schwinn name, called the Homegrown series.[62] In 2001, Schwinn/GT declared bankruptcy. As a result, during the Preference Period, lenders were monitoring Debtors’ borrowing base and periodically sweeping cash from the Debtors’ operating accounts. Additionally, Debtors’ sales, inventory levels, and accounts receivable all had decreased markedly during 1992, further restricting Debtors’ borrowing base and their access to financing. All of these factors left the Debtors’ during the Preference Period with insufficient cash to pay their vendors’ outstanding invoices or with which to acquire new shipments of product. By 1990, other United States bicycle companies with reputations for excellence in design such as Trek, Specialized, and Cannondale had cut further into Schwinn’s market. Unable to produce bicycles in the United States at a competitive cost, by the end of 1991 Schwinn was sourcing its bicycles from overseas manufacturers.
